About the role
We are looking for an Operations Coordinator to support and optimize our grocery operations in Riyadh. This role plays a key part in ensuring smooth day-to-day functioning of our operations, while driving performance improvements through data, planning, and collaboration.

What you'll do

  • Support Operational Performance: Assist in monitoring key operational metrics such as order fulfilment, stock availability, picking accuracy, and quality.

  • Process Improvement: Identify areas for improvement and create SOPs to streamline operations.

  • Capacity Planning: Plan shift structures and manpower based on demand patterns.

  • Team Management: Supervise the operations team and foster a positive and productive environment.

  • Training Sessions: Conduct training on SOPs and perform spot checks to evaluate performance.

  • Quality & Accuracy Maintenance: Ensure catalogs reflect accurate product details, pricing, and availability.

  • Team Collaboration: Work closely with logistics, commercial, and customer support teams to ensure seamless operations.

  • Conduct Interviews: Lead the hiring process for the operations team.
